Abstract
The present application provides a single port wide band impedance matching circuit and method for providing antenna matching. The single port wide band impedance matching circuit includes a single signal port adapted for receiving a wide band signal. The single port wide band impedance matching circuit further includes an impedance matching circuit including a narrow band harmonic bypass. Still further, the single port wide band impedance matching circuit includes an antenna port coupled to the single signal port via the impedance matching circuit.
